Transaction 70bbefc67bc93b243859389f9a15322668ace27d7dc6c68265b123c43f1b67bf
1 Input
1 Output
-
70bbefc67bc93b243859389f9a15322668ace27d7dc6c68265b123c43f1b67bf:0
- value
- 2691812
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2ee3dc7b7528853065d6be11f48c70949eaed2e
- address
- bc1qcthrm3ah22y9xpjad0s37jx8p9y74mfw7wg2wl